Transaction 17bce2e02f622ef0082e5d8b0235e95d4502fc05afab86d239268b7f7a02581e

block
860d2ada492185bb5460c0ea4bbe270e3cfba6b18476697d20df23c2cd0ac1d8

49 Inputs

36 Outputs